Collaborative Research Networks in Humanities

The Collaborative Research Networks in Humanities funding initiative seeks to advance interdisciplinary projects among higher education institutions, facilitating collaboration and innovation in humanities research. This program is particularly aimed at creating digital frameworks for sharing resources, knowledge, and findings among scholars, while excluding funding for individual research projects that lack collaborative elements. This initiative emphasizes network-building that dismantles traditional silos in academic research.

This funding supports several models of collaboration. For instance, a consortium of universities developed a shared digital archive focused on women's contributions to science over the past century, resulting in numerous joint publications and research outputs. Another example involved a collaborative workshop series that brought together humanities scholars from various disciplines to explore data-sharing methodologies and engage in cross-institutional projects that redefined public history narratives.

Institutions looking to apply must demonstrate an existing commitment to collaborative efforts, as well as the capacity to build and sustain research networks. Successful proposals need to outline potential partnerships, the nature of the research collaboration, and how digital platforms will facilitate knowledge exchange. Conversely, solo research endeavors or projects that do not actively encourage interdisciplinary collaboration may not meet the competitive criteria for this funding.

Alignment with national priorities in higher education is crucial, particularly those that promote interdisciplinary studies and collaborative scholarship. Emerging trends call for institutions to adopt practices that enhance resource sharing and public engagement, setting a framework in which humanities research can thrive. Applicants should also clearly define their research questions and articulate how their projects contribute to academic advances and societal understanding of complex issues.

In conclusion, the Collaborative Research Networks in Humanities funding promotes interconnectivity among scholars and fosters innovation in research methodologies. By emphasizing collaboration and resource sharing, this initiative aims to produce significant academic outputs that contribute to the evolution of humanities scholarship in the digital age.
